Digitalization and Test for Dynamic and Flexible Operation of PtX Components and Systems

Project Details

Description

The overall objective for DynFlex is to develop new methods for dynamic modelling, testing and flexible operation of individual PtX components and systems, supporting scale-up, business case and technology platforms for production of green fuels.
